**Ticket: Config drift on PointsKeeper ledger nodes**

New folks: the PointsKeeper loyalty-points ledger runs on three nodes, and we found that node-2 was provisioned manually last quarter, so its settings no longer match the baseline managed by our deploy tool. Symptoms include mismatched accrual rounding and delayed redemption postings. Before reconciling, verify each node against the canonical baseline. The expected configuration values are listed below.

service settings:
novath:
  pin: 1396
  tenant: pelys
  seal: seal_ccc035e1
  metrics_host: metrics.novath.qorvelworks.test
  standby_team: fraeth
  escalation: drueth-zorok
  nonce: 61d508

**Ticket: Config drift on BounceSift processor**

The email bounce processor in the Larkfield environment has drifted from the values committed in the release branch. Retry windows and suppression thresholds no longer match, which likely explains the duplicate suppression entries reported Tuesday. Please reconcile before the Thursday cut. For reference, the currently deployed configuration on the live node reads as follows.

config for yajep-yahof:
[briax]
port = 9200
region = outer-2
host = briax.nelvrocorp.test
team = raleth
timeout_ms = 1500
retries = 1

Subject: Thursday cage visit — Kellbright DC

Hi all,

Front desk here. The engineers from Norwick Compute are due Thursday at 10:00 for the quarterly inspection of our cage in Hall 2. Assistants, please pre-register them on the Kellbright portal and have the visit sheet printed. They'll need escorting from the lobby. The access code for our cage is below.

turnstile pass: bdg-QZV-3

Merrowline offers consolidated routing through the Astervale hub, projected to cut transit times by two days and freight cost per unit by roughly 9%. Branch managers: please audit open purchase orders, confirm carrier labels are updated, and brief warehouse staff before cutover weekend. Drayhall contracts wind down under a 60-day notice clause. The broader supply-chain strategy driving this change is noted below.

confidential, kagep-kahof: Druokax Systems plans to lower the Ulaath list price by 53 percent in March.